This patch was applied to netdev/net.git (master)
by Jakub Kicinski <kuba@kernel.org>:
On Wed, 21 Sep 2022 17:27:34 +0800 you wrote:
> tfilter_put need to be called to put the refount got by tp->ops->get to
> avoid possible refcount leak when chain->tmplt_ops != NULL and
> chain->tmplt_ops != tp->ops.
>
> Fixes: 7d5509fa0d3d ("net: sched: extend proto ops with 'put' callback")
